While there are lots of reasons ice can collect in or around your cooling system, the most likely culprit is a lack of preventive servicing. Taking small steps to keep your air conditioner clean will go a long way in stopping the formation of ice.
Some of these routine tasks include the following:
Replacing the Air Filter
If your air filter is dirty or clogged, air can’t move over the evaporator coil, which is a vital step in the cooling process. This affects refrigerant inside the coil and produces extra moisture, which turns to ice. We encourage checking your filter monthly and replacing it when you can’t see light through it.
Cleaning the Coil
Even if you swap your air filter on a regular basis, a dirty coil can also ice over. Checking Refrigerant Levels
Without adequate refrigerant, the evaporator coil can’t take in as much heat and may ice up. As a result, your home will be hotter and unpleasant. Servicing Electrical Wiring
Damaged wiring will disrupt the blower motor. Without steady airflow, the temperature may drop, and ice will form.
